We build futures through housing and hands-on skills.

Today’s young people face soaring housing costs, anxiety, and uncertainty about work. At 500 Acres, we give them land, tools, and training to build homes, grow food, and strengthen their communities. But we cannot achieve our mission alone. Find out how you can help.

Our Fellowships

The 500 Acres Design Fellowship gives 18–25 year olds hands-on experience reimagining housing and community design—drawing inspiration from Stanford’s d.school and Japanese architecture firm VUILD
